Edoardo D’Imprima is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Structural Biology and Surfaces, Coatings and Films. According to data from OpenAlex, Edoardo D’Imprima has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 593 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Structural Biology and 4 papers in Surfaces, Coatings and Films. Recurrent topics in Edoardo D’Imprima’s work include Advanced Electron Microscopy Techniques and Applications (7 papers),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(4 papers) and Electron and X-Ray Spectroscopy Techniques (4 papers). Edoardo D’Imprima is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Electron Microscopy Techniques and Applications (7 papers),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(4 papers) and Electron and X-Ray Spectroscopy Techniques (4 papers). Edoardo D’Imprima coll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United States and United Kingdom. Edoardo D’Imprima's co-authors include Janet Vonck, Werner Kühlbrandt, Deryck J. Mills, Ricardo Sánchez and Martin Jechlinger and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of Biological Chemistry and The Journal of Cell Biology.
